您现在的位置是:首页 > 科技 > 正文

MySQL实现分页查询的SQL 🌟

发布时间:2025-04-01 13:01:17弘冰舒来源:

导读 在日常开发中,分页查询是数据库操作中的常见需求。MySQL提供了灵活的方式实现分页功能,通常通过`LIMIT`关键字来完成。例如,假设我们有一...

在日常开发中,分页查询是数据库操作中的常见需求。MySQL提供了灵活的方式实现分页功能,通常通过`LIMIT`关键字来完成。例如,假设我们有一个用户表`users`,需要展示第2页的数据,每页显示10条记录,可以使用以下SQL语句:

```sql

SELECT FROM users LIMIT 10 OFFSET 10;

```

这里`OFFSET 10`表示跳过前10条数据,从第11条开始获取。此外,还可以用更简洁的方式书写:

```sql

SELECT FROM users LIMIT 10, 20;

```

上述语句同样表示从第11条数据开始,获取接下来的10条记录。需要注意的是,分页查询的性能与排序字段的选择密切相关,建议为分页字段添加索引,以提升查询效率。

如果你正在处理大数据量的分页需求,可以考虑结合缓存或优化查询逻辑,避免频繁操作数据库。MySQL的强大功能加上合理的SQL设计,能够轻松应对各种复杂的分页场景!💪

标签:

上一篇
下一篇